Hotel Policies
  • Check-in is available from 3:00 PM, allowing guests to settle in comfortably.
  • Check-out must be completed by 11:00 AM, which helps the hotel prepare for new arrivals.
  • Reception is open until 11:59 PM, making it convenient for late check-ins.
  • The property offers free Wi-Fi, a nice perk for those who need to stay connected.
  • Parking is complimentary, saving you some extra money during your stay.
  • The hotel has non-smoking rooms and floors, ensuring a pleasant environment for all guests.
  • There’s one restaurant and one bar/lounge on-site, providing dining options without needing to venture far.
  • Extra beds can be requested at an additional cost of KRW 20,000 (advance reservation needed), useful for families or groups.
  • Breakfast prices are KRW 42,000 for adults and KRW 28,000 for children (with advance booking discounts).
  • Free breakfast is provided for children under 36 months when dining with guests.
  • The hotel opened in 2019 and has six floors with a total of 51 rooms.

Nearby Attractions
  • Cheonjiyeon Falls: A breathtaking waterfall that’s perfect for a peaceful walk and stunning photos.
  • Jeongbang Waterfall: Unique because it falls directly into the ocean; it’s a must-see for nature lovers!
  • Teddy Bear Museum: A fun place for families, showcasing adorable teddy bears in various themes.
  • Hallasan National Park: Offers beautiful hiking trails with diverse flora and fauna; great for adventure seekers.
  • O’sulloc Museum: Perfect for tea enthusiasts to learn about Korean tea culture and enjoy some delicious green tea.
  • Mysterious Road (Dokkaebi Road): An intriguing spot where you can experience the optical illusion of rolling uphill!
  • Dongmun Market: A vibrant local market where you can taste authentic Jeju street food and shop for souvenirs.
  • Manjanggul Cave: One of the longest lava tubes in the world; fascinating geology that everyone should explore.
